How to Tell If Your Dog Trusts You

Building trust with your dog is essential for a strong bond. Here are some signs that indicate your dog trusts you: 1. **Relaxed Body Language:** A dog that feels safe around you will have a relaxed body posture, with ears and tail in a natural position. 2. **Eye Contact:** Maintaining eye contact with you shows trust and affection. 3. **Following You:** If your dog follows you around the house, it's a sign of trust and reliance on you. 4. **Showing Vulnerability:** Dogs will expose their belly or let you touch sensitive areas like paws if they trust you. 5. **Calm Behavior:** A dog that is calm and content in your presence is likely to trust you deeply. 6. **Responding to Your Cues:** Following your commands and cues demonstrates trust in your leadership. 7. **Seeking Affection:** Seeking physical contact, like leaning on you or snuggling, is a clear sign of trust. 8. **Excitement When You Return:** If your dog greets you enthusiastically when you come home, it's a sign of trust and attachment.
